Mike Gasper is part of a long line of outstanding student-athletes who have helped distinguish Allegheny as one the most decorated golf programs in NCAA Division III history.
Arriving as a rookie in 1996, Gasper led the Gators to the first of four consecutive North Coast Athletic Conference championships while earning First Team All-Conference and All-Region honors in the process.
The Gators qualified for the NCAA Championships all four years during Gasper’s tenure, including a fourth-place national finish in 1997 and a third-place effort at NCAA’s in 1998.
Although Allegheny boasts a rich history on the links, Gasper is one of only three players to garner All-Region honors all four years. He powered to medalist honors at the 1996 NCAC Championships and was a three-time tournament champion.
Behind a slew of top-10 finishes, Gasper earned All-America honors after the 1997 and 1998 seasons.
